Tidy Your Camping Tent Routinely
Cleansing your tent is important to maintaining it in good condition and preventing concerns like foul odors or a zipper that does not work as well as it should. Utilizing a non-detergent, pH-neutral soap or a cleaner that's made particularly for outdoors tents ensures that you clean the fabric and zippers without harming them.

Begin by spot-cleaning any kind of particularly filthy areas with a cloth or sponge and a small amount of light soap. Next, load a bathtub with awesome to lukewarm water and add your selected camping tent cleaner. Comply with the instructions on the bottle for the length of time to soak your camping tent.

When you prepare to wash, drainpipe and dry your outdoor tents, making certain to completely wash the within the camping tent and that all soap is entirely removed. After it's dried out, set up the outdoor tents outdoors in a shaded location to maintain it from sun damages and permit it to air-dry completely prior to you store it. Consider spraying it with a waterproofing agent, particularly if you utilize your tent often and in wet weather conditions.

Repair Small Tears or Leaks
The last thing you want on your outdoor camping trip is to wake up in the middle of the evening to a trickling tent. The good news is, most small issues can be conveniently repaired in the field with a bit of time and patience.

For small rips in the mesh of your camping tent, use a piece of equipment tape to spot it. You can additionally try an air duct tape in a pinch. Make certain to apply the patch in a tidy and completely dry setting to ensure it sticks and holds.

If a camping tent pole obtains stepped on, kinked or snapped, it must be quickly attended to in the field before it aggravates. Depending upon the severity, you might need to change it totally or have it properly repaired. If you are a REI member, they supply repair service services to get your equipment back in functioning problem. Or else, talk to regional outside stores for specialist outdoor tents repair service options. Most will certainly deal with you on guarantee declares as well.
